Multiple Choice Questions (MCQ) on Electrical Engineering Materials for Electrical Engineering
1. The converse of hardness is known as
(a) malleability
(b) toughness
(c) softness
(d) none of the above
Ans: c
2. The tiny block formed by the arrangement of a small group of atoms is called the
(a) unit cell
(b) space lattice
(c) either (a) or (b)
(d) none of the above
Ans: a
3. The co-ordination number of a simple cubic structure is
(a) 2
(b) 4
(c) 6
(d) 8
Ans: c
4. The metal having the lowest temperature coefficient of resistance is
(a) gold
(b) copper
(c) aluminium
(d) kanthal
Ans: a
5. The kinetic energy of a bounded electron is
(a) less than that of unbounded electron
(b) greater than that of unbounded electron
(c) equal to that of unbounded electron
(d) infinite (e) none of the above
Ans: a
6. A highly conductive material must have
(a) highest conductivity
(b) lowest temperature co-efficient
(c) good mechanical strength
(d) good corrosion resistance
(e) easy solderable and drawable quality
(f) all of the above
Ans: f
7. Superconductivity is observed for
(a) infrared frequencies
(b) d.c. and low frequency
(c) a.c. and high frequency
(d) frequencies having no effect
(e) none of the above
Ans: b
8. The superconductivity is due to
(a) the crystal structure having no atomic vibration at 0°K
(b) all electrons interact in the super-conducting state
(c) the electrons jump into nucleus at 0°K
(d) none of the above
Ans: a
9. The value of critical field below the transition temperature will
(a) increase
(b) decrease
(c) remain unchanged
(d) any of the above
Ans: a
10. Superconductors are becoming popular for use in
(a) generating very strong magnetic field
(b) manufacture of bubble memories
(c) generating electrostatic field
(d) generating regions free from magnetic field
Ans: a
11. High resistivity materials are used in
(a) precision instruments
(b) heating elements
(c) motor starters
(d) incandescent lamps
(e) all of the above
Ans: e
12. Which of the following resistive materials has the lowest temperature co-efficient of resistance? (a) Nichrome
(b) Constantan
(c) Kanthal
(d) Molybdenum
Ans: a
13. The coils of D.C. motor starter are wound with wire of
(a) copper
(b) kanthal
(c) manganin
(d) nichrome
Ans: c
14. The transition temperature of mercury is
(a) 18.0°K
(b) 9.22°K
(c) 4.12°K
(d) 1.14’K
Ans: c
15. By increasing impurity content in the metal alloy the residual resistivity always
(a) decreases
(b) increases
(c) remains constant
(d) becomes temperature independent
Ans: b
16. At transition temperature the value of critical field is
(a) zero
(b) negative real value
(c) positive real value
(d) complex value
Ans: a
17. Which of the following variety of copper has the best conductivity?
(a) Induction hardened copper
(b) Hard drawn copper
(c) Pure annealed copper
(d) Copper containing traces of silicon
Ans: c
18. Constantan contains
(a) silver and tin
(b) copper and tungsten
(c) tungsten and silver
(d) copper and nickel
Ans: d
19. Piezoelectric materials serve as a source of _____.
(a) resonant waves
(b) musical waves
(c) microwaves
(d) ultrasonic waves
Ans: d
20. In thermocouples which of the following pairs is commonly used?
(a) Copper-constantan
(b) Aluminium-tin
(c) Silver-German silver
(d) Iron-steel
Ans: a
21. Overhead telephone wires are made of
(a) aluminium
(b) steel
(c) ACSR conductors
(d) copper
Ans: b
22. Most of the common metals have _____ structure.
(a) linear
(b) hexagonal
(c) orthorhombic
(d) cubic
Ans: d
23. Which of the following affect greatly the resistivity of electrical conductors?
(a) Composition
(b) Pressure
(c) Size
(d) Temperature
Ans: a
24. _____ is a hard solder.
(a) Tin-lead
(b) Tin-silver-lead
(c) Copper-zinc
(d) None of the above
Ans: c
25. Non-linear resistors
(a) produce harmonic distortion
(b) follows Ohm’s law at low temperatures only
(c) result in non-uniform heating
(d) none of the above
Ans: a
26. In graphite, bonding is
(a) covalent
(b) metallic
(c) Vander Waals
(d) Vander Waals and covalent
Ans: d
27. Total number of crystal systems is
(a) 2
(b) 4
(c) 7
(d) 12
Ans: c
28. The conductivity of a metal is determined by
(a) the electronic concentration and the mobility of the free electrons
(b) the number of valence electrons per atom
(c) either (a) or (b)
(d) none of the above
Ans: a
29. The resistivity of a metal is a function of temperature because
(a) the amplitude of vibration of the atoms varies with temperature
(b) the electron density varies with temperature
(c) the electron gas density varies with temperature
Ans: a
30. Due to which of the following reasons aluminium does not corrode in atmosphere?
(a) Aluminium is a noble metal
(b) Atmospheric oxygen can only diffuse very slowly through the oxide layer which is formed on the surface of aluminium
(c) No reaction with oxygen occurs ft Any of the above
Ans: b
31. Carbon rods are used in wet and dry cells because
(a) carbon rod serves as conductor
(b) carbon can resist the attack of battery acid
(c) both (a) and (b)
(d) either (a) or (b)
Ans: c
32. Which of the following high resistance materials has the highest operating temperature?
(a) Kanthal
(b) Manganin
(c) Nichrome
(d) Eureka
Ans: a
33. Which of the following materials is used for making coils of standard resistances?
(a) Copper
(b) Nichrome
(c) Platinum
(d) Manganin
Ans: d
34. The conduction of electricity, in semiconductors, takes place due to movement of
(a) positive ions only
(b) negative ions only
(c) positive and negative ions
(d) electrons and holes
Ans: d
35. Selenium is _____ semiconductor.
(a) extrnisic
(b) intmisic
(c) N-type
(d) P-type
Ans: b
36. ________ has the best damping properties.
(a) Diamond
(b) High speed steel
(c) Mild steel
(d) Cast iron
Ans: d
37. The photo-electric effect occurs only when the incident light has more than a certain critical
(a) intensity
(b) speed
(c) frequency
(d) wave length
Ans: c
38. Superconducting metal in super conducting state has relative permeability of
(a) zero
(b) one
(c) negative
(d) more than one
Ans: a
39. The carbon percentage is least in
(a) low carbon steel
(b) wrought iron
(c) cast iron
(d) malleable iron
Ans: b
40. For a particular material, the Hall coefficient was found to be zero. The material is
(a) insulator
(b) metal
(c) intrinsic semiconductor
(d) none of the above
Ans: b
